The spirit of holiday giving was alive and well in East Multnomah County as the local Sheriff's Office wrapped up its "Fill the Cruiser Toy Drive." The initiative successfully delivered a touch of Christmas magic to over 1,100 children from 280 families. The effort, a now annual tradition spearheaded by the Multnomah County Sheriff's Office (MCSO), once again demonstrated the community's generosity and compassion.

For the weeks leading up to the distribution event, deputies and volunteers collected hundreds of new, unwrapped toys across city hall locations in Fairview, Wood Village, Maywood Park, and Troutdale. The drive saw a collaboration with various city partners, who helped gather the generous donations. A notable turnout was at local retail locations where deputies and volunteers staffed tables, witnessed by the MCSO Community Events Team, which organized the drive according to MCSO's announcement.

The actual giveaway took place on December 13, 2025, transforming an area church into a holiday wonderland for families to pick out toys. Parents received a unique opportunity to ‘shop’ for their children, with deputies and volunteers on-hand to wrap the gifts. “Our goal for the giveaway is to create a welcoming, festive environment where parents can shop with dignity, so their kids can look forward to a brighter holiday,” Multnomah County Deputy Sheriff Jessie Volker was quoted as saying.
